How to Write a International Relations Researcher Resume

Browse International Relations Researcher resume examples built around research methodology (Ethnographic, survey, mixed methods), tailored for Social Sciences…

A strong International Relations Researcher resume leads with a focused professional summary that names the exact role and your standout achievement. In the experience section, open every bullet with a strong action verb and quantify the result with numbers wherever possible. Highlight your most relevant competencies — especially Research Methodology (Ethnographic, Survey, Mixed Methods), Statistical Analysis (SPSS, R, STATA), and Qualitative Methods (Interviews, Focus Groups, Discourse Analysis) — in a dedicated Skills section positioned early so ATS systems and hiring managers both find it immediately.

For format, most International Relations Researcher roles suit a reverse-chronological layout: most recent position first, working backwards. Keep to one page for under five years of experience, or two pages for senior candidates with a rich project or leadership history. Use clean, ATS-safe fonts (10–12pt), standard section headings (Summary, Experience, Education, Skills), and avoid tables, text boxes, or multi-column layouts that applicant tracking systems cannot parse reliably.

What is the best resume format for Social Sciences professionals?

A reverse-chronological format is the standard choice for most Social Sciences candidates — employers expect to see your most recent role first, working backwards. If you are transitioning into Social Sciences from a related field, a hybrid format (brief skills summary at the top followed by chronological experience) can bridge the gap effectively. Keep the document to one page for under five years of experience, or two pages for senior specialists.

How do I make my Social Sciences resume pass applicant tracking systems (ATS)?

Use standard section headings — Summary, Experience, Education, Skills — rather than creative labels that ATS parsers do not recognise. Embed domain keywords such as "Research Methodology (Ethnographic, Survey, Mixed Methods)" and "Statistical Analysis (SPSS, R, STATA)" naturally inside your experience bullets rather than cramming them into a standalone keyword list. Avoid tables, multi-column layouts, text boxes, headers, footers, and images — these confuse most modern parsers and can cause your resume to be misread or rejected before a human sees it.
